Robbie Williams slams 'bully' podcaster

Robbie Williams has hit back at a "bully" podcaster who labelled him a "fraud".

The British singer has spoken out after hosts of the World Cup Of... podcast shared a clip in which they harshly criticised him.

In the video posted on Instagram, one of the hosts claimed that Robbie, who rose to fame as a member of Take That in the '90s, "got lucky being in Gary Barlow's band", referencing his former bandmate.

The host added, "You're not a rockstar, you're a fraud."

Elsewhere in the episode, the podcaster recalled Robbie attending Glastonbury early in his career.

"Robbie Williams never been a fan of him," he said. "I think it was the year before, I think he attended Glastonbury with bleached blonde hair, knocked about with Liam Gallagher, probably just shared a big bag of f**king gear."

The host also described the singer as a "Redcoat", a term used for holiday camp entertainers at Butlins, a chain of British holiday resorts.

Robbie, 52, later took to social media to respond to the comments.

"My algorithm sent me this," he stated. "I went to Glastonbury because people my age went to Glastonbury. I've never called myself a rock star. Not once. I was on the bag. You end up where you end up."

"I grew up on holiday camps. What's wrong with being a Redcoat? Or lucky? I know exactly who and what I am," the singer continued. "You, however, display a kind of cruelty that doesn't even recognise itself. Scary. I'm a real Redcoat. You're a real bully. I know which one I'd rather be."

Robbie concluded by offering to show the hosts around "one of my houses, so you can see exactly how lucky I've been", adding, "I'll send my plane to pick you up".
